To tie it all together, I am using an Apple Airport Extreme (main base station), three Airport Expresses, a set of Harmon/Karmdon Soundsticks (iMac), a Bose 1-2-3 system (Den), a Bose Wave Radio (bedroom) and a JBL Onstage (bathroom).
The iMac is connected to the network by ethernet cable to the main base station, which serves the three Expresses wirelessly.
It is all quite silly, though not terribly expensive, to have music capable of playing in most rooms of my home.
